Graduate Degrees in Artificial Intelligence
The professional masters in AI prepares engineers, applied scientists and technical professionals for career advancement in advanced technical leadership roles in the rapidly growing 麍eld of arti麍cial intelligence engineering. The core curriculum addresses a breadth of areas central to AI engineering expertise including machine learning, statistical learning, data mining and ethics.
The MS-AI is offered online and on campus. Whether you are seeking a program that promotes a flexible learning schedule or one that offers in-person interaction with peers and faculty, youll find the same rigorous curriculum that will help you advance your career.
